This evaluation is undertaken on behalf of the UNDP as a final evaluation of the decentralisation component of the programme ‘Civil Service Reform Strategy and Implementation Plan for Decentralised Service Delivery in the Emerging Regions of Ethiopia. The mission’s understanding of the purpose of this evaluation is that, given the pilot nature of the programme, a primary focus is on the institutional capacity of the woredas and kebeles to manage and implement projects and programmes, implementation of small scale infrastructural projects, and the potential to upscale the programme to regional levels.
In addition it is understood that the UNDP seeks a strategic review of its pilot intervention that will enable it to assess the potential to replicate an alternative approach for decentralized service delivery, support national decentralization policies, and assess its comparative advantages in donor support.
